DiDonato Performs Neruda Songs
Advertisement
2025/26 CSO Artist-in-Residence Joyce DiDonato is “a supreme artist, as much through sheer triumph of spirit as through musicianship” (Financial Times). The esteemed mezzo-soprano sings the Neruda Songs, Peter Lieberson’s heartbreakingly sensuous song cycle set to the poetry of Pablo Neruda. Edward Gardner concludes the program with Walton’s tumultuous and alluring First Symphony.
